Stockholm, Sweden (Sports Network) - A doubles tandem of David Nalbandian and Horacio Zeballos notched a big win on Saturday, as visiting Argentina grabbed a 2-1 lead over Sweden in their first-round best-of-five Davis Cup battle.
Nalbandian and Zeballos doused a Swedish duo of Robin Soderling and Robert Lindstedt 6-2, 7-6 (7-4), 7-6 (7-5) at Kungliga Tennis Hall.
The winner will be decided in Sunday's reverse singles here, when Soderling meets Leonardo Mayer and Swede Joachim Johansson takes on Eduardo Schwank.
In Friday's opening singles here, the French Open runner-up Soderling handled Schwank 6-1, 7-6 (7-0), 7-5 before Mayer pulled Argentina even with a 5-7, 6-3, 7-5, 6-4 victory over the 6-foot-6 slugger Johansson. Mayer was initially scheduled to play doubles on Saturday, but was replaced in the lineup by the former Wimbledon runner-up Nalbandian.
Former Swedish star Thomas Enqvist is leading the home team this week, while Tito Vazquez captains Argentina on the indoor hardcourt here.
Sweden owns seven Davis Cup titles, while Argentina has never hoisted the coveted chalice.
The winner here will face either Russia or India in the quarterfinals in July.
